Acts 10:38 "I mean Jesus of Nazareth. God has anointed him with the Holy Spirit and with power. Jesus went around helping people and healing all who were afflicted by demons, because God was with him."


Even when Jesus became a human being, He served by being one with God the Father, always surrendering to the power of God the Heazvenly Father.


Jesus' life was dedicated to giving only what God the Heavenly Father could give.

That is our example as well.


We too can only give to those around us what God gives to us.

Moreover, what God gives us becomes our character, something that we unconsciously and naturally exude to influence those around us.


For this reason, we can be nurtured by God by knowing who He is, asking Him for our deficiencies, and looking up to Him.


God wants to be with us. If we only ask for it, God will work abundantly in us and harmonize our character with His character.
